Hi there! It's fantastic that you're looking for NCAA Division 2 schools that value both academics and athletics. Here are some high academic D2 schools you might want to consider:
1. Truman State University - Known for its strong liberal arts and sciences programs, Truman State has a solid academic reputation while also offering competitive sports teams.
2. Bentley University - This business-focused school is known for its strong programs in finance, accounting, and marketing, as well as its sports programs.
3. Rollins College - Located in Florida, Rollins offers small class sizes and a liberal arts education. Their athletics department boasts numerous conference championships.
4. Stonehill College - A small liberal arts school in Massachusetts, Stonehill has an excellent reputation for academics and various successful athletic programs.
5. California Polytechnic State University, Pomona - Cal Poly Pomona is known for its applied learning approach and strong programs in engineering, business, and more. Their sports teams are quite competitive as well.
6. Point Loma Nazarene University - This private Christian school in San Diego is known for its strong academics, particularly in business, nursing, and biology, while also offering competitive sports teams.
7. University of California, San Diego - UCSD is a public university known for strong STEM programs and research opportunities. Although it transitioned to NCAA Division 1 in 2020, it has a history in Division 2 with successful sports teams.
As you can see, there are quite a few strong academic options among Division 2 schools. Remember to consider factors such as location, size, and available majors in addition to athletic programs when conducting your search. Good luck in your college search and application process!
